What is Epoxy Flooring?
At its most basic, epoxy refers to a mix of a resin and a hardening chemical. The most straightforward definition of epoxy flooring refers to a flooring surface made of several layers applied to a floor at least two millimetres deep. Mixing the resin and hardening agent turns the mixture into a hard plastic over a few days. Before it hardens, the mixture is poured onto a concrete floor and allowed to set. As each layer hardens, another layer is poured on it until finished.
Types of Epoxy Floors
There are several types of epoxy floor choices for you, depending on your needs. It can help to know about some of the more common options available to help you choose the right epoxy flooring for you. Some of the most common include:
- Self-levelling – Self-levelling epoxy is typically applied over old and broken concrete floors to make the surface smooth and level again. Since it’s an epoxy surface, this also makes the floor more durable in the future. Self-levelling systems also come in a variety of colours. Whether you’re looking to decorate your flooring or you need to highlight traffic patterns and work zones, this is an excellent option for you.
- Epoxy mortar – Epoxy mortar systems are the most robust systems available. The flooring is usually made 100% solids epoxy and mixed in with graded or quartz sand. This system is typically impact- and chemical-resistant, making it a good pick for places where heavy equipment is used (e.g. warehouse, service area, and garage flooring).
- Quartz-filled – Quartz-filled epoxy floors mix in coloured quartz grains with a high-performance epoxy resin. This results in a multifunctional floor that’s durable, slip-resistant, and decorative.
- Anti-static – Anti-static epoxy flooring helps reduce static hazards that could be dangerous on the job. This system includes a conductive material that gathers static electricity to dissipate potentially hazardous discharges. This is a highly recommended system for environments with flammable materials.
- Epoxy flake– Flake floor systems are another excellent choice if you’re looking for a striking design. Coloured chips and shavings are mixed in with the epoxy to make aesthetically-pleasing designs you can use to make your interiors more visually stunning. The slightly rough surface also helps reduce slips and falls, making the floor safer as well.
Benefits of Epoxy Flooring
Epoxy flooring provides plenty of benefits aside from giving you attractive and exciting designs for your floors. These systems are quite functional and offer many advantages that make them a wise investment. Some of the benefits you can expect from installing epoxy flooring include:
- Affordability – Epoxy flooring can be a wise investment, given how cost-effective it is. The costs of installing epoxy flooring can vary depending on location, but it’s generally more affordable than the alternatives. Other flooring options can be far more costly, especially if you go with an option that requires your current flooring material to be removed. Epoxy can be installed over existing flooring, especially concrete, making it less cost- and labour-intensive. Epoxy can also be installed within a few days, which can mean less downtime and a smaller impact on productivity. Given that epoxy flooring can last a long time, your floor is an investment that can last for years to come with the right care.
Low-maintenance – Epoxy systems tend to be low-maintenance and easy to clean. One issue with typical concrete flooring is that it’s porous and easy to stain. In contrast, epoxy flooring has much simpler upkeep. The epoxy coating creates a surface that keeps out dust and liquids. Sweeping and mopping are made considerably more straightforward. If you need to do more substantial cleaning, epoxy also resists scratching. That said, refrain from using acidic products for cleaning to avoid dulling the surface.
- Durable – Epoxy flooring tends to have a longer lifespan than most other flooring materials. Concrete can last just as long, but it needs to be properly sealed and maintained to avoid taking damage. With the right care, epoxy systems can last for years, allowing you to enjoy your flooring without worrying about replacement.
- Safe – Epoxy flooring can be used to make fire-, slip-, and heat-resistant flooring to give your interior more protection. Additives can be added to the mixture to make the smooth surface more stability. Because it’s so durable, epoxy flooring is also impact-resistant, preventing the formation of damage and abrasions that could present tripping hazards. Epoxy flooring is shiny and reflective, increasing visibility indoors and helping prevent accidents.
- Resistant – Epoxy floors are resistant to all kinds of chemicals that could cause corrosion (e.g. oil, gasoline, cleaning fluid). This makes installing epoxy flooring a wise idea for locations that deal with chemicals regularly, like garages. Installing an epoxy system would protect your floor from most chemical spills without damaging the coating. Epoxy is also water-resistant, which can help prevent water damage and improve the lifespan of your floor. It also resists bacteria and germs, making your floor easier to sanitize.
Convenient – Epoxy flooring is relatively quick and easy to install. Since it takes less time for the epoxy to cure, it can be installed faster than most other methods and lead to less downtime. Give it a few days, and your business can get back to work in less time, allowing you to minimize unproductivity. The durability of epoxy solutions also means less wear and tear on the floor, allowing you to continue working when you might otherwise need to repair the floor.
- Customizable – Many people may consider epoxy floors shiny and glossy. They are, but there are plenty of options to allow you to customize your floor as you see fit. For example, you have the option of adding some colour to your floors to spice up your interior. Alternatively, you can arrange the flooring into different patterns or designs. If you’re going with a specific theme for the space, there’s a colour to suit your preferences. With all the choices available, think of it as a convenient way to upgrade the look of your floor and improve the atmosphere of the interior.
